Create Your Own Power Plan
You are allowed to create your own Power Plan and customize it to meet personal
requirements.
1. Click [Create a power plan] in [Power Options].
2. Start with an existing plan and give the new power plan a name. Click [Next] to
continue.
3. Change the settings for the plan. Click [Create] to make the customized power plan
taking effect.
4. Now you have a new power plan that is automatically set as active.
